(Spanish II Para Empezar (Introduction), Chapters 1A, 1B, 2A, 2B, 3A)
Grammar Objectives:
Use personality and nationality adjectives and apply the grammatical concept of gender and number to adjectives
Conjugate and know the uses
between the verbs “ser” and “estar”. Use Spanish interrogatives
Conjugate and use the present tense
of regular verbs
Read, listen to, and produce grammar and vocabulary within context
Cultural Objectives:
Know cultural differences between U. S. schools and Spanish speaking countries

(Spanish II Para Empezar (Introduction), Chapters 1A, 1B, 2A, 2B, 3A)
Communication Objectives:
Discuss your daily routine
Describe yourself and others
Grammar Objectives:
Review verbs and expressions that use the infinitive
Use reflexive verbs
Review the differences between “ser” and “estar”
Use possessive adjectives and express
possession
Read, listen to, and produce grammar and vocabulary within context
Cultural Objectives:
Understand cultural perspectives on clothes, family events and special occasions
